A dairy plant manager oversees the operations and production processes of a dairy plant. They are responsible for managing the daily activities of the plant, ensuring efficient production, maintaining quality standards, and meeting production targets. The dairy plant manager also oversees the inventory management, scheduling, and maintenance of equipment. They collaborate with various departments, such as procurement, quality control, and distribution, to ensure smooth operations and timely delivery of products. Additionally, they are responsible for implementing and enforcing safety and hygiene standards, training and supervising staff, and analyzing production data to identify areas for improvement.

Dairy Plant Manager salary in Denmark
Average Yearly Salary of Dairy Plant Manager in Denmark is approximately 752,559 DKK (107,747 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Denmark is a Scandinavian country located in Northern Europe. It has a population of approximately 5.8 million people and covers an area of around 43,094 square kilometers. The country consists of the Jutland Peninsula and numerous islands, including Zealand, Funen, and Bornholm.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 494,627 DKK (73,200 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Dairy Plant Manager job salary compared to average salary in Denmark.
Comparison shows that a person working as Dairy Plant Manager in Denmark earns on average:
1.52 times the average salary (or 152% of average salary).
